Mortgage pre approval is kinda this thing where a lender looks over your financial info, and then figures out how much money they’re willing to lend you for a home purchase. In this phase , the lenders check your income, your credit score employment history, debt, and also other financial details.
After you’re approved, the lender hands you a pre approval letter, which basically shows the estimated loan amount you qualify for. That letter signals to sellers that you’re ready, and financially prepared to buy a home.
The real estate market can move quickly, especially in competitive areas where more than one buyer is eyeballing the exact same property. Having Mortgage pre approval before you start house hunting, it gives you a real leg up , a kind of advantage that counts.
